Over-wintering Blackcap

I have had an over-wintering male blackcap on my feeder by my house (Aberystwyth) for the first time since April 2006. Before that there were always 2 or 3 quite regularly each winter since 1997 when I first started recording them. Local friends have had the same pattern. I don’t know why they have disappeared for the last two winters. Milder weather? Any ideas? There is a treecreeper which has discovered a climbing hydrangea just beside my window and it has turned up to feed there for several days now. Obviously they don’t just use big old trees.
